We compared two Desktop platform GPUs: 8GB VRAM Radeon RX 570X and 2GB VRAM Radeon R9 285 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D Radeon RX 570X 's Advantages
Released 3 years and 7 months late
Boost Clock1244MHz
More VRAM (8GB vs 2GB)
Larger VRAM bandwidth (224.0GB/s vs 176.0GB/s)
256 additional rendering cores
Lower TDP (150W vs 190W)
